Settings & Performance Optimization

How can I improve my FPS (frames per second) in Roblox games?

To improve your Roblox FPS, lower your in-game graphics quality and rendering distance. Ensure your graphics drivers are updated, close background applications, and consider using a wired internet connection. These steps significantly reduce system strain, leading to smoother gameplay.

Why am I experiencing constant lag or high ping in Roblox?

Lag and high ping in Roblox are often due to a poor internet connection, distant servers, or network congestion. Use an Ethernet cable, close bandwidth-heavy background tasks, and check if your router's Quality of Service (QoS) settings can prioritize gaming traffic. This helps stabilize your connection.

What are the best graphics settings for a balanced experience in Roblox?

For a balanced Roblox experience, manually set your graphics quality to around 5-7 bars, and adjust rendering distance moderately. This provides a good visual fidelity without overly taxing your system. Experiment to find the optimal balance that suits your specific hardware capabilities.

How do I fix stuttering issues in Roblox?

To fix stuttering, update your GPU drivers, clear Roblox's cache files, and check for background applications consuming resources. Disabling "Fullscreen optimizations" for `RobloxPlayerBeta.exe` can also resolve some stuttering problems. Consistent stuttering might indicate underlying hardware issues.

How do I report a player for inappropriate behavior in Roblox?

To report a player, click the menu icon in the top-left corner of the game screen (often three lines or a Roblox icon). Find the player in the player list, click their name, and select "Report Abuser." Follow the prompts to detail their misconduct. Roblox takes reports seriously to maintain a safe environment.

Why can't I join my friends in a popular Roblox game?

You might be unable to join friends due to different game versions, server capacity limits, or privacy settings. Ensure both of you have the latest Roblox client. If the server is full, you might need to wait. Check your friend's privacy settings to ensure they allow joins.

Bugs & Fixes

My Roblox game keeps crashing. How can I troubleshoot it?

Frequent crashes can stem from outdated drivers, corrupted game files, or insufficient system resources. Update your graphics drivers, verify Roblox client integrity by reinstalling, and monitor your PC's RAM/CPU usage during gameplay. Overheating components can also cause crashes; ensure adequate cooling for your system.

What do I do if my Robux purchase didn't go through?

If a Robux purchase didn't go through, first check your bank/payment method statement to confirm the transaction. If charged but Robux aren't credited, wait a few hours. Then, contact Roblox Support directly with your transaction details and receipt. Avoid attempting multiple purchases to prevent further issues.

You'll get to the bottom of it! 8. **Q:** What are some advanced tips for optimizing Roblox client settings beyond basic graphics for competitive play in 2026? **A:** For competitive play in 2026, we're going beyond just graphics sliders. First, delve into your graphics control panel (NVIDIA Control Panel or AMD Radeon Software). Force Roblox to use your dedicated graphics card if you have one, and set "Texture filtering - Quality" to "High Performance" and "Power management mode" to "Prefer maximum performance." This ensures your GPU isn't holding back. Also, disable "Fullscreen optimizations" in Roblox's executable properties (right-click `RobloxPlayerBeta.exe` > Properties > Compatibility). Consider using an external FPS counter and overlay tool to monitor real-time performance, which helps in fine-tuning. Ensure Windows Game Mode is enabled, but experiment with disabling Game Bar, as it can sometimes introduce overhead. For serious competitive players, looking into advanced CPU affinity settings through Task Manager can sometimes provide minor gains by dedicating more cores to Roblox. Always keep your Windows OS updated. While these aren't always massive changes, stacking these small optimizations can give you that crucial competitive edge. It's all about squeezing every bit of performance out of your rig. Investing in these can really elevate your game! 10. **Q:** Are there any specific network settings or router configurations that can improve Roblox connection stability and reduce packet loss in 2026? **A:** Absolutely, optimizing network settings and router configurations can significantly improve Roblox connection stability and reduce packet loss in 2026. First, enabling Quality of Service (QoS) on your router is paramount. Prioritize your gaming device and Roblox traffic over other network activities. This ensures your game data gets preferential treatment. Next, consider using Google DNS (8.8.8.8, 8.8.4.4) or Cloudflare DNS (1.1.1.1) in your network adapter settings, as these can sometimes offer faster routing than your ISP's default. Updating your router's firmware is also critical; manufacturers often release updates that improve stability and security. Experiment with different Wi-Fi channels if you're still on wireless, as crowded channels can cause interference. For those on a wired connection, checking your Ethernet cable for damage or upgrading to a Cat6 or Cat7 cable can make a difference. Disabling Universal Plug and Play (UPnP) on your router and manually setting up port forwarding for Roblox (though often not strictly necessary, it can help in specific edge cases) might also be beneficial. It's about creating the cleanest, most efficient data path possible for your game. Don't let a shaky connection cost you a win!

You'll feel the difference in how alive these worlds become! 13. **Q:** What strategies do professional Roblox game developers employ to minimize lag and maximize performance for games with very high player counts in 2026? **A:** Professional Roblox game developers employ sophisticated strategies to minimize lag and maximize performance for high player count games in 2026. A primary strategy involves aggressive client-side optimization, meaning offloading as much processing as possible to the player's machine. This includes efficient asset streaming (only loading what's immediately needed), culling unseen objects, and using Level of Detail (LOD) systems for distant models. Server-side, they focus on optimized networking code, minimizing data sent between client and server, and using spatial partitioning to only process interactions between nearby players. Load balancing across multiple server instances is also crucial for massively popular experiences. Developers might use advanced scripting techniques to pool resources and efficiently manage physics calculations, especially in games with many moving parts or complex environmental interactions. Utilizing Roblox's built-in performance monitoring tools and custom analytics allows them to identify bottlenecks in real-time. Continuous profiling and iterative optimization are standard practices. It’s a constant battle to keep performance smooth, especially with the sheer scale of some Roblox titles. This meticulous approach ensures that even with hundreds of players, the game remains responsive.
